Choosing the Right Bracket for Your Feeder Type
Selecting the correct hardware depends entirely on the design of the feeder and the temperament of the herd. A stationary ground bunk requires different mounting mechanics than a suspended hay rack. Consider the pivot points of the design and where the most significant stress will be placed during feeding.
Always evaluate the mounting surface before purchasing brackets. A wooden fence post has different requirements than a metal pipe rail or a cinder block wall. Using the wrong bracket on the wrong surface leads to instability and potential injury to the livestock.
Finally, consider the environmental exposure. Areas prone to high moisture, heavy snow, or salt air require galvanized or powder-coated steel to prevent premature degradation. The initial choice of material often dictates the frequency of maintenance for years to come.
Mounting Brackets Securely for Cattle Safety
Secure mounting is more than a matter of convenience; it is a critical safety practice. Use high-grade carriage bolts rather than screws whenever possible, as bolts resist shear force much better than threaded fasteners. Ensure every bracket is flush against the mounting surface to prevent gaps where livestock could catch a rope, ear tag, or leg.
Check the tightening of all nuts and bolts after the first week of use. The settling of lumber and the vibration of cattle nudging the feeder often loosen connections that felt rock-solid during installation. A quick torque check once a month keeps the system safe and prevents structural fatigue.
Always install brackets at heights recommended by breed standards to prevent cattle from attempting to stand in or climb onto the feeder. When a feeder is properly secured, the risk of accidental tipping or entanglement is virtually eliminated.
DIY Feeder Materials: Wood vs. Metal vs. Poly
The choice of feeder material impacts how the brackets interact with the structure. Metal is the most durable, but it can be loud and prone to vibration, which may spook more skittish animals. Wood offers a softer contact point and is easier to modify on-site, though it is susceptible to rot if not treated with food-safe preservatives.
Poly (polyethylene) is a popular, lightweight choice that resists rust and is generally safer for livestock, but it requires specialized brackets that won’t crack the plastic under pressure. These feeders often need a steel frame or backing plate to distribute the force of the bracket.
Choose materials based on the local climate and the tools available. A well-built wooden frame with galvanized steel brackets often provides the best balance of longevity, cost, and ease of assembly for the average hobbyist.
Maintaining Your DIY Feeder for a Longer Life
Maintenance starts with regular visual inspections. Look for signs of bent metal, loose hardware, or structural shifting after any significant storm or high-activity period. Addressing a slightly loose bracket today prevents a total structural collapse tomorrow.
Keep the mounting area clean of debris and wet hay, as trapped moisture creates a breeding ground for rust and rot. If the bracket finish begins to chip or peel, apply a quick coat of cold-galvanizing spray or exterior-grade paint to seal the exposed steel.
Finally, consider the seasonal cycle. Before winter, ensure all bolts are snug and the brackets are free of debris. Preparing the feeder for the colder months ensures that the herd has reliable access to feed when forage is scarce and the equipment is under the most stress.
